Write an equation in slope intercept form that goes through the point (0,-2) and has a slope of 3

Mathematics
2 answers:
andrezito [222]3 years ago
7 0

Slope intercept form is in the form of y=mx+b, where m is the slope and b is the y-intercept.

The slope is given, which is 3.

The y-intercept is the value of y when x is 0. In the point (0,-2), x=0 and y=-2; thus, the y-intercept is -2.

Substituting m=3 and b= -2 into the slope-intercept equation gives us:

y = 3x - 2

A bicycle shop sells only bicycles and tricycles. Altogther there are 23 seats and 50 wheels. How many bicycles and tricycles ar
slamgirl [31]

Answer:

The number of bicycles is 19.

and the number of tricycles is 4.

Step-by-step explanation:

As we know that the number of seats in bicycles as well as in tricycles is 1.

The number of wheels in bicycles is 2

and the number of wheels in tricycles is 3.

Let the number of bicycles be x.

and the number of tricycles be y.

Thus using the given information we can make equation as,

x + y = 23

and, 2x + 3y = 50

Solving these two equations:

We get, x = 19 and y = 4

Thus the number of bicycles is 19.

and the number of tricycles is 4.
